What does the future hold for the thawing Arctic?

In “Unfrozen: The Fight for the Future of the Arctic,” Mia Bennett and Klaus Dodds explore the complex changes occurring in the Arctic due to climate change and geopolitical tensions. The book examines topics like Indigenous sovereignty, economic development, and military infrastructure, offering a comprehensive look at the region’s past and future. Bennett and Dodds highlight three potential scenarios for the Arctic: an extractive Arctic driven by oil and gas development, an endangered Arctic exacerbated by climate change, and an adversarial Arctic marked by geopolitical conflicts. These scenarios illustrate the challenges and opportunities facing the Arctic as it becomes increasingly significant on the global stage.
